Publisher Description
For years, 10-year-old Zelly Fried has tried to convince her parents to let her have a dog. After all, practically everyone in Vermont owns a dog, and it sure could go a long way helping Zelly fit in since moving there from Brooklyn. But when her eccentric grandfather Ace hatches a ridiculous plan involving a "practice dog" named OJ, Zelly's not so sure how far she's willing to go to win a dog of her own. Is Ace's plan so crazy it just might work . . . or is it just plain crazy?
Erica S. Perl weaves an affectionate and hilarious tale that captures the enduring bond between grandparents and grandchildren. Even when they're driving each other nuts.

About Erica S. Perl
Erica S. Perl is
the author several picture books and the young adult novel Vintage Veronica, which Publishers
Weekly called “wonderfully fun!” In addition to writing books, Erica works
at First Book, a nonprofit organization that has provided more than seventy
million new books to children in need. She lives in Washington, DC, with her
family.
About Abigail Revasch
Abigail Revasch is an Earphones Award–winning narrator and an actress. She has starred in television shows such as 7th Heaven and ER and has narrated numerous video games and commercials, as well as audiobooks. She holds a BA in theater arts from Northwestern University.
